Why These Are the Top Cabinet Installers Contractors in North Bend

** The cabinet installation market serving North Bend, Nebraska, is characterized by a reliance on reputable contractors from nearby larger towns like Fremont (~15 miles away) and Columbus (~20 miles away). As a rural community, there are no dedicated cabinet installation companies operating solely within North Bend's city limits. The market is not overly saturated, but competition among the regional providers is strong, driven by reputation, word-of-mouth, and demonstrated quality of work. The average quality of service is high, with most top-tier providers being family-owned businesses with decades of experience, emphasizing personalized customer service and craftsmanship. Typical pricing for professional cabinet installation in this region is moderate, reflecting Midwestern cost-of-living. Homeowners can expect a range from **$2,000 - $5,000** for standard kitchen cabinet replacement (materials not included) to **$5,000 - $15,000+** for full custom design, fabrication, and installation projects. Most contractors in this area are licensed and insured, which is a critical factor for homeowners to verify before proceeding with a project.

1What is the typical cost range for professional cabinet installation in North Bend, and what factors influence the price?

In the North Bend area, a full kitchen cabinet installation typically ranges from $2,000 to $6,000 for labor, depending heavily on the project's complexity and the cabinet source. Key cost factors include whether you supply ready-to-assemble (RTA) cabinets versus custom ordered units, the need for wall modifications or plumbing/electrical adjustments, and the installer's travel time from nearby hubs like Fremont or Omaha. Local material and fuel costs can also subtly influence final quotes compared to other regions.

2How does Nebraska's climate, with its humidity swings and dry winters, affect my cabinet installation or choice of materials?

Nebraska's significant seasonal humidity changes can cause wood cabinets to expand and contract, making professional installation that allows for proper expansion gaps crucial. We recommend choosing materials like plywood boxes (more stable than particleboard) and finishes well-sealed against moisture, especially for kitchens and bathrooms. A reputable local installer will acclimate your cabinets in your home for several days before installation to minimize future warping or door alignment issues common in our variable climate.

3Are there specific permits or regulations in North Bend, NE, I need to be aware of for a cabinet installation project?

For a standard cabinet replacement that doesn't alter plumbing or electrical layouts, a permit is usually not required in North Bend or Dodge County. However, if your installation involves moving gas lines, plumbing, or electrical outlets (common in kitchen remodels), you must comply with Nebraska state building codes, and permits may be necessary. Always consult with your installer or the North Bend City Clerk's office to confirm requirements, as rules can differ for homes inside versus outside city limits.

4What's the best time of year to schedule cabinet installation in Eastern Nebraska, and how long does the process usually take?

Late spring through early fall is ideal for scheduling, as weather is less likely to delay deliveries or affect travel for installers. The installation itself for an average kitchen typically takes 1-3 days for a skilled professional, but you must account for the entire timeline: ordering cabinets (which can take 4-12 weeks), potential demolition, and any necessary subcontractor work. Planning several months ahead is wise, especially to avoid the peak contractor season which aligns with favorable Midwestern weather.

5How should I choose a reliable cabinet installer serving the North Bend community, and what questions should I ask?

Seek local referrals from neighbors or hardware stores in Fremont/North Bend and verify the installer is licensed and insured to work in Nebraska. Ask specific questions like: "Can you provide references from projects within Dodge County?", "How do you handle unexpected issues like unlevel floors or walls common in older area homes?", and "Will you handle the disposal of old cabinets?" A trustworthy local professional will understand regional supply chains and be transparent about their process and timeline.
